Abstract:
This paper presents a model of filtration process in a fractured porous medium. The filtration velocity in a porous medium is described by Darcy law, and in fractures is described by Forchheimer law. To describe filtration through fractures on a fine grid, Discrete Fracture Model (DFM) is used. To reduce the size of the discrete problem, Online Meshfree Generalized Multiscale Finite Element Method (Online MFGMsFEM) is developed. The results of numerical calculations showed higher accuracy relative to the offline multiscale method.
